Do you remember Thrasher Mag’s old Skate Rock tapes? The bands that bridged a staggered transition between death metal and hardcore? “Skate Rock” was coined in the early ’80s and made famous by the magazine’s skater bands. This year, Thrasher and Volcom Entertainment bring “Skate Rock Vol. 12″, a double disc featuring unreleased and live tracks from Alkaline Trio, Millencolin, Only Crime, Planes Mistaken For Stars, Turbonegro, and pro skater bands The Heartaches, Shed, Gnarkill [Read More...]

This is another good punk / hardcore comp from Thrasher in a long long history of Thrasher comp. Its impossible to compare this to the original “Skate Rock” comps of the early 80’s with bands like Drunk Injuns, Free Beer, The Big Boys, and McRad, but its definitly got some good tracks on it (Only Crime, Die Hunns). Plus, the DVD that should come with this has a great live show video from Turbonegro.
